Lexington, SC — On the afternoon of Monday, September 28, 2020, information was given by several sources to detectives that a human fetus had been delivered by a woman at her home within the Town of Lexington and that she had taken the fetus to a residence in the City of Columbia, where it was buried.
The Lexington County Coroner’s Office, Richland County Coroner’s Office, and the Lexington Police Department executed a search warrant for the residence and property of 2315 Wallace Street in the City of Columbia.
On Wednesday, Chief Terrence Green said the search had ended.
“The multi-day search on Wallace Street in the City of Columbia has concluded,” Green said. “This remains an active investigation but no further information will be released at this time.”
